The year 2025 will be remembered as one of the most viral and talked-about years for Nigerian celebrity weddings. From multi-destination love stories to cultural spectacles and historic firsts, these weddings didnโt just make headlines; they broke the internet, setting social media ablaze with viral hashtags, millions of views, and trending moments across platforms like Instagram, TikTok, and X (formerly Twitter).
1. Priscilla Ojo & Juma Jux โ #JP2025 (AprilโMay)
Leading the pack in 2025 was the wedding of Priscilla Ojo daughter of Nollywood star Iyabo Ojo and Tanzanian singer Juma Jux. Tagged #JP2025, this multi-stage union captured hearts from early April through a traditional Yoruba celebration in Lagos, and later a reception in Tanzania. From vibrant fashion and celebrity guests to coordinated aso ebi looks that dominated timelines, this cross-national wedding generated tens of millions of views and trended for weeks on social media.

2. Mr Eazi & Temi Otedola โ The Three-Continent Wedding (JuneโJuly)
Music entrepreneur Mr Eazi and actress-fashion influencer Temi Otedola took luxury weddings to a new level with a three-city celebration spanning Monaco, Dubai, and Iceland. Beginning with an elegant civil ceremony in Monaco, followed by a traditional Yoruba wedding in Dubai, and concluding with a glamorous white wedding in Iceland, the event became one of the most stylish and widely shared stories of the year. Vogue highlighted their looks and global settings, adding to the massive online engagement.

3. Davido & Chioma โ #Chivido2025 (August)
Afrobeats legend Davido and longtime partner Chioma continued their love story with an opulent white wedding held in Miami, USA. Widely referred to as #Chivido2025, the wedding dominated entertainment news, featured high-profile attendees, and generated millions of online interactions as fans shared photos,videos, and reactions that trended across platforms.

4. Shawn Faqua & Dr. Sharon Ifunanya โ The โTrain Weddingโ (September)Creativity and culture collided when Nollywood actor Shawn Faqua and event planner Dr. Sharon Ifunanya Maduekwe exchanged vows aboard a moving train on the LagosโIbadan Standard Gauge Railway. Dubbed Nigeriaโs first train wedding, the ceremony became an instant internet favorite for its novelty and emotional moments, sparking the hashtag #TrainWeddingNaija and millions of social impressions.

5. Ruby Ojiakor & Moc Madu โ #AsaOnwa2025 (May)
Actress Ruby Ojiakor and filmmaker Moc Madu sealed their love story in Imo State with a vibrant traditional wedding that celebrated cultural heritage, fashion, and heartfelt moments. Tagged #AsaOnwa2025, this wedding was widely shared for its emotional significance and energetic coverage by celebrities and fans alike.

6. Eve Esin & Suleman Mohammed โ #LoveFoundMe25
(October)Veteran Nollywood actress Eve Esin also made waves with her culturally rich wedding to Suleman Mohammed in Akwa Ibom. With coral bead adornments, traditional regalia, and a themed celebration that honored Efik heritage, their wedding created engaging visual content that circulated widely online.

7. Ife Agoro (Ife) & Frank Itom โ Traditional & Cultural Celebration (December)
Lifestyle influencer Ifedayo Ife Agoro and Frank Itom had a beautiful wedding journey in 2025, including an intimate civil ceremony earlier in the year and a traditional wedding this December, a few days to Christmas that quickly went viral on social media. The celebration featured rich cultural details, elegant outfits, and heartfelt family moments captivating online audiences and fans across Nigeria.
